Linux系统是搭建数据库环境的常见选择,因其稳定性、安全性和灵活性而受到广泛欢迎。在开始之前,确保系统已安装并更新至最新版本,这有助于减少潜在的安全漏洞和兼容性问题。
选择合适的数据库管理系统(如MySQL、PostgreSQL或MariaDB)是关键步骤。根据业务需求决定使用哪种数据库,并通过官方仓库或源码编译方式进行安装。安装过程中需注意配置文件的设置,例如数据存储路径、端口分配和权限管理。
数据库优化涉及多个方面,包括但不限于索引优化、查询语句调整、内存与缓存配置。合理使用索引可以显著提升查询效率,但过多索引会降低写入性能。定期分析慢查询日志,可以帮助识别需要优化的SQL语句。
系统层面的优化同样重要。调整Linux内核参数,如文件描述符限制、网络参数和I/O调度策略,能够提升数据库的整体性能。•合理规划磁盘分区和使用RAID技术,有助于提高数据读写速度和可靠性。

AI艺术作品,仅供参考
定期备份和监控是保障数据库稳定运行的重要措施。使用自动化工具进行数据备份,并设置监控系统实时跟踪CPU、内存、磁盘和数据库状态,能够在问题发生前及时预警。